We size systems for North Hollywood’s actual conditions: sustained summer heat that shaves 10-15% off panel output and LADWP’s net metering rates that changed in 2023. No brochure math, no undersized arrays. Learn more about our Solar Panel Installation in North Hollywood.

With LADWP’s time-of-use rates now shifting peak pricing to late afternoon and evening, a battery bank changes your payback math significantly. We install FranklinWH and Tesla systems sized to carry your overnight load, not just check a box. Learn more about Solar Battery Storage & Backup in North Hollywood.

Why North Hollywood’s Climate & Housing Affect Solar
North Hollywood sits on the valley floor, ringed by the Santa Monica Mountains to the south and the Santa Susana range to the north. Marine layer almost never reaches this far inland. Summer temperatures regularly exceed 105°F for weeks at a stretch, and that heat drives the highest residential cooling loads in LA County. Your AC runs from June through October, sometimes through November now. That’s why solar payback periods here are shorter than almost anywhere in coastal California, and why an undersized system is such a common complaint. Panels running in sustained extreme heat lose 10-15% of rated output, so system sizing and inverter placement aren’t optional details here, they’re the whole game.
The housing stock adds another wrinkle. Most of North Hollywood’s owner-occupied homes are post-WWII wood-frame bungalows and two-story stucco buildings from the 1940s through 1960s. A lot of them still carry original 100-amp electrical panels. Before a solar-plus-storage system can be permitted with North Hollywood Solar Battery Storage & Backup, that panel typically needs an upgrade to 200-amp service, which routinely adds $2,000-$4,000 to project costs. Any installer who quotes you solar without checking your panel first is guessing. We check first.
Pricing for Solar in North Hollywood
What follows are honest ranges, not a promise. Every roof, panel, and bill is different. But here’s what we see across North Hollywood homes:
- Residential solar installation (4-8 kW, typical 2-3 bedroom bungalow): $12,000-$22,000 before federal tax credit
- Battery backup add-on (FranklinWH aGate or Tesla Powerwall): $12,000-$18,000 installed
- 100-amp to 200-amp panel upgrade (often required): $2,000-$4,000
- Solar panel cleaning (full array): $150-$300 per visit
- EV charger installation (Level 2, with existing capacity): $800-$1,800
- Repair work: $200-$800 most common; $40 off any repair over $200
The federal tax credit covers 30% of system and battery costs. LADWP’s net metering program still credits excess generation, though at rates lower than what you pay in the evening. Call (877) 550-6892 for an exact quote based on your bill, estimates are free.
